At What Age Should We Attempt To Retrieve Sperm?
This paper addresses the controversial issue of whether it is advantageous to harvest testis tissue from adolescents with an extra 47th X chromosome, in a “heroic” attempt to preserve that child’s chances of reproduction in future adult life. According to the authors, “the answer, appears to be ‘No’ (…) We can justifiably wait until adulthood with equivalent chances of success.”
